ASTM B338 vs B861 vs B862 Titanium Tube and Pipe

ASTM B338, ASTM B861 and ASTM B862 cover different titanium products and should not be treated as interchangeable specifications. B338 is the usual starting point for titanium tube used in condensers and heat exchangers; B861 covers seamless titanium pipe; B862 covers welded titanium pipe. The correct choice follows the equipment design, product dimensions, manufacturing route and required acceptance tests.

Titanium tube and pipe supplied to ASTM B338 B861 and B862

ASTM B338 vs B861 vs B862 at a Glance

SpecificationPrimary product scopeManufacturing routeTypical purchasing context
ASTM B338Titanium and titanium-alloy tube for surface condensers, evaporators and heat exchangersSeamless or welded, as specifiedOD-and-wall tube for heat-transfer equipment
ASTM B861Titanium and titanium-alloy seamless pipeSeamlessProcess piping specified by NPS or outside diameter and wall
ASTM B862Titanium and titanium-alloy welded pipeFormed from flat-rolled product and weldedWelded process pipe where the design permits this route

The table is a scope guide, not a substitute for the current standard or project specification. The purchase order should state the applicable edition and any supplementary requirements.

How to Choose the Correct Specification

Choose by function before dimensions

A tube installed in a condenser or shell-and-tube heat exchanger is normally specified from the equipment standard and tube-sheet design. A line carrying process fluid between equipment items is normally treated as pipe. Similar outside dimensions do not make the products equivalent because tolerances, test requirements and ordering conventions can differ.

Confirm seamless or welded construction

B338 can cover either route when properly ordered. B861 is specifically seamless pipe, while B862 is welded pipe. Do not infer construction from a polished surface; confirm it through the purchase specification, material certificate and manufacturing records.

Match grade to the actual environment

The product standard does not select the alloy grade. Grade 2, Grade 7, Grade 12 and other permitted grades have different corrosion and mechanical selection bases. Review fluid composition, concentration, temperature, pressure, aeration, chlorides, crevices, flow conditions, fabrication and design code before final selection.

Dimensions, Condition and End Requirements

For B338 tube, state outside diameter, wall thickness, length, tube condition, tolerances, surface and end requirements. For B861 or B862 pipe, state NPS or outside diameter, schedule or wall thickness, length, end preparation and any dimensional standard referenced by the design. Also define whether cut-to-length pieces, bevels, cleaning, marking or fabrication allowances are required.

Inspection and Documentation

Required examinations depend on the governing specification and order. They may include chemistry, tensile properties, dimensional inspection, flattening or flaring tests, hydrostatic or pneumatic testing, and eddy-current, ultrasonic or other nondestructive examination. State acceptance criteria, certificate type, heat or lot traceability, inspection witness points and third-party requirements before production.

RFQ Checklist

  • Application and governing equipment or piping design code
  • ASTM specification and edition, alloy grade and UNS number
  • Seamless or welded route
  • OD or NPS, wall or schedule, length and quantity
  • Condition, tolerances, surface, ends and fabrication requirements
  • Pressure or NDE requirements, certificate type and third-party inspection
  • Packaging, destination and required delivery date

FAQ

Can ASTM B338 tube replace ASTM B861 pipe of a similar size?

Not automatically. The design, tolerances, testing, end use and applicable code must accept the proposed product. Obtain engineering approval before changing specifications.

Does Grade 2 material comply with all three standards?

Grade 2 chemistry alone does not establish compliance. The finished product must meet the selected specification, dimensions, condition, properties, tests and documentation.

Is welded titanium pipe always a lower-grade option?

No. It is a different manufacturing route. Suitability depends on the design specification, weld quality controls, inspection plan, dimensions and service conditions.
